区块链核心技术详解:破解数字经济背后的秘密

    时间:2025-04-14 02:19:42

    主页 > 微博 >

    <strong dropzone="rva"></strong><em id="yqf"></em><time dir="38v"></time><ins dropzone="_9x"></ins><time draggable="hgh"></time><ul lang="2st"></ul><dfn dir="t33"></dfn><code dropzone="q33"></code><map draggable="ixj"></map><dl dropzone="upo"></dl><code id="mly"></code><sub date-time="e8y"></sub><em dropzone="h_s"></em><strong lang="z3i"></strong><abbr date-time="vmh"></abbr><strong dropzone="nd9"></strong><noscript dropzone="w56"></noscript><legend dir="qzf"></legend><u date-time="h_a"></u><b dropzone="kff"></b><ul lang="dmh"></ul><font lang="933"></font><sub dir="z6d"></sub><b date-time="yt5"></b><abbr id="ejy"></abbr><var lang="gjp"></var><noscript id="aic"></noscript><area draggable="65o"></area><em draggable="6mo"></em><map draggable="lne"></map><tt id="if2"></tt><small dropzone="n98"></small><abbr id="n2i"></abbr><bdo lang="fng"></bdo><b dir="iet"></b><noscript dir="fbm"></noscript><i draggable="p39"></i><em date-time="p4a"></em><ul dir="lgd"></ul><i dir="wyj"></i><noframes id="zel">

            区块链技术近年来已经成为全球科技和商业领域的重要话题。由于它在安全性、透明性和去中心化等方面展现出的独特优势,区块链技术已经被视为现代数字经济的基础设施。在这篇文章中,我们将深入探讨区块链的核心技术,包括其基本概念、结构、共识机制、智能合约、加密算法等。同时,我们还将解决一些常见的相关问题,以便更好地理解这一复杂而富有潜力的技术。

            区块链的基本概念及结构

            区块链技术的基础是由一系列区块(Block)组成的链(Chain)。每个区块都包含了一些交易记录以及指向前一个区块的哈希值(Hash)。这种设计确保了数据的不可篡改性,任何对区块数据的修改都会导致相连区块的哈希值发生变化,从而使得整个链失效,确保了数据的安全性。

            区块链通常分为公有链、私有链和联盟链三种类型。公有链是完全开放的,任何人都可以参与并验证交易;私有链则是封闭的,只有被许可的用户可以访问;联盟链则介于两者之间,通常是由多个组织共同管理。

            共识机制的角色与类型

            区块链核心技术详解:破解数字经济背后的秘密

            在区块链网络中,所有参与者必须就交易的有效性达成一致,这就是所谓的共识机制。共识机制在保障区块链网络安全性的同时,也决定了网络的性能和效率。

            常见的共识机制包括:

            智能合约的定义与应用

            智能合约是一种自执行的合约,它的条款直接写入代码中,运行在区块链网络上。智能合约的出现使得区块链的应用场景从简单的价值传递扩展到更加复杂的商业逻辑执行。

            智能合约的主要优点包括:

            智能合约的应用非常广泛,包括金融交易、供应链管理、身份验证、版权保护等。每一个智能合约在执行时都保证着不可逆性,一旦代码部署,任何人都无法修改合约的内容。

            加密算法在区块链中的重要性

            区块链核心技术详解:破解数字经济背后的秘密

            加密算法是保护区块链网络安全的基石。它通过确保用户身份的安全和数据的完整性,来维护区块链的可信性。

            主要的加密方法包括:

            区块链的挑战与未来

            尽管区块链技术有着巨大的潜力,但也面临许多挑战。这些挑战主要包括:

            未来,随着技术的进步和应用场景的不断扩展,区块链有可能会解决这些挑战,成为社会和经济发展的重要基础设施。

            相关问题探讨

            1. 区块链技术是如何实现数据安全与隐私保护的?

            区块链技术通过其去中心化的特性以及加密算法来实现数据的安全与隐私保护。具体来说,数据在生成时会经过哈希处理,形成一个唯一的数字指纹,这样能够确保数据的不可篡改性。同时,非对称加密算法让用户在进行交易时可以安全地传输敏感信息,保证交易双方的身份隐私。此外,一些区块链网络的设计允许用户选择性地公开他们的信息,从而让用户在享受区块链带来透明性的同时,也能够保护自己的隐私。

            2. 区块链与传统数据库的比较

            传统数据库通常是集中式的,数据由一个中心管理。相比之下,区块链是一种去中心化的数据结构,任何人都可以在网络中验证和访问数据。传统数据库更适合需要高并发和复杂查询的场景,而区块链则更适合需要数据透明和不可篡改的场合。此外,区块链的数据记录是按时间序列链式存储,便于追踪审计,而传统数据库则没有这一优势。此外,在处理大规模数据时,区块链的性能仍然面临挑战。

            3. 什么是区块链的分叉?

            区块链的分叉是指在区块链网络中,因协议的升级或其他原因而导致的两条或多条路径的形成。分叉可以分为软分叉和硬分叉。软分叉允许向后兼容,修改较小的规则,而硬分叉则会导致不向后兼容的重大变更,形成两个不同的区块链,例如比特币和比特币现金的分叉。分叉可以是出于改善网络性能、增加功能或应对安全问题等目的,但也可能导致网络的分裂和相关的社区争议。

            4. 区块链如何应用于供应链管理?

            区块链在供应链管理中的应用可以带来增强的透明度和追踪能力。通过将每一笔交易或事件记录在区块链上,参与者可以实时追踪物品的位置、状态和历史记录。在供应链的每个环节,从原料采购到成品交付,所有的过程都可以由区块链进行记录,从而确保数据真实性。这种透明度不仅可以提高效率,还能够降低欺诈风险。同时,消费者也更愿意选择那些能够提供透明和验真的产品的品牌,提升了品牌的信誉。

            5. 区块链的未来发展趋势是怎样的?

            未来,区块链技术可能迎来更加广泛的应用,包括但不限于金融服务、医疗健康、身份认证、物联网等。在技术层面上,区块链的可扩展性有望得到改善,新型共识机制的研究将使得交易确认速度更快。此外,随着法律法规的逐渐明晰,企业将更愿意探索区块链的商业潜力,同时新项目和平台的不断涌现也将推动区块链生态的发展。技术的进步和用户的接受度都将使区块链在未来的数字经济中发挥更加重要的作用。

            总之,区块链技术的核心技术不仅为现代社会带来了便捷和安全,也在不断推动着各行业的变革。希望通过本文的详细介绍,能够让读者更深入地理解区块链的魅力与挑战。